So I'm very new to this forum and just got in to some pc case modding. This project that I've just started is my first ever custom pc desk that I'm making so i thought I would share it with you guys. I've documented alot of the progress so far so I will add some pictures as the project is progressing. There are also some sketches that i made in sketchup to give me some kind of blueprint to work from and to give me a general idea of what i wanted my desk to look like.

I will also mention that this is kind of a budget build since my plans at the moment are that I will put my current pc in this desk wich includes the following parts:

Intel i5 6500
Z170 MOBO
240mm A-I-O cooling
16gb 3000mhz ram
GTX 1070
650watt psu

This is something that I hopefully will be available to update pretty soon since a pc-desk is not really complete without a custom water cooling loop. But for the moment there is just not enough €€/$$.

I've named the desk B-2 Stealth since i think that the shape of the desk reminds me alot of the B-2 stealth bomber jet so nothing more fancy or cheesy just a shape thingy! :p

I did a fluid change and decided to go with mayhems pastel white. I think that it fits the builds colour theme perfectly and I will definately keep it this way for some time. I also made a radiator cover from a piece of acrylic which turned out pretty good in my opinion ;) And offcourse I want to show off who made the custom loop possible Alphacool and Aquatuning so thanks alot again to you guys! I have to say the temps are very good right now I did some tests by running my overclocked gtx 1070 on heaven benchmark loop and on the same time I also put my overclocked i5 6500 (4,4ghz) on 100% load by looping cinebench r15 and i couldnt get my cpu to hit more then 56c on the package and my gpu got to a max temp of 32c so I can only say that I'm very happy to see theese kind of results. Yeah and even better i had all of my fans and the alphacool vpp755 waterpump set to silent mode in the asus bios
